In this week's episode of Pull Up a Chair, hosts Brandee Blocker Anderson and Haleh Rabizadeh Resnick break down the increasingly blurry lines between ethics, law, and real-life choices. Today, they tackle a high-stakes question for modern working professionals: Should you post on social media?

Using the classic legal framework IRAC (Issue, Rule, Analysis, Conclusion), Brandee and Haleh weigh the professional risks and rewards of putting yourself out there online.

What's Inside the Episode:

  • The Pro-Posting Case: Brandee argues for the immense value of social media—like LinkedIn, Instagram, and YouTube—in boosting career visibility, establishing thought leadership, and opening unexpected doors.
